Good day,

I just received 8 IPC-HDW5231R-ZE through Andy. I've read a bunch of posts about setting up these cameras. I'm still a little confused.

Here is my set up. Pc hooked up to a POE switch which is then hooked up to one of the cameras.

Do I change my ip on the pc to the exact ip of the camera? 192.168.108

Then what is process and what am I doing? Do I change each camera to a different IP address? Do I need an internet connection to do this?

No don't set the computer to the same IP. Every device needs a unique IP address but they also need to be on the same subnet.
In other words set the PC's IP address to something between 192.168.1.2-192.168.1.254, but not *.108.

Connect the cameras one at at time, and change their ip addresses as you do.

start slow
1) what is the IP address of your router ?
2) what is the IP address of your computer ?

The first three numbers of each should be the same .

if the first three number are 192.168.1 then I would set the first camera to 192.168.1.201.
Use Internet explorer Or download PALEMOON 32 bit. to login to your camera at 192.168.1.108 to change the IP address . Make use you set the ip address to static, disable DHCP.
